One of many men known as the man of a thousand voices.
Was found dead in his car clutching a photograph of his ex-lover, Milicent Patrick. A vacuum cleaner hose attached to the exhaust had funneled the fumes into his car.
Committed suicide at the peak of his career.
Remembered as the star of the "Jeff Regan" and as the announcer and co-owner of "Satan's Waitin" radio shows.
His mother was Ethel Briggs, a lyric soprano in light opera.
Radio actor and producer.
Graham supplied the voices of the "Fox and Crow" in their 1941-50 Columbia animated cartoon series.
At the time of his demise, Graham resided at 9115 Wonderland Avenue in Los Angeles.
